Access to tree.Jet in src/definitions.py: possible source of errors

Calling tree.Jet in src/definitions.py (this line) will access different jet collections depending on the input sample. The Jet collection is CHS in Run2 samples and PUPPI in Run3 samples. This may cause users to retrieve jet collections inconsistently.

Things can get more complicated when accessing non-standard flavors of NanoAOD, e.g. JMENano where both PUPPI and CHS are available, or custom JMENano with additional ABC collections. A way to deal with this (more elegant than hard-coding the collections to be retrieved) may be needed.

'plot_level' not used in DYModule.py

While QCDModule.py uses the 'plot_level' option to decide whether or not to plot responses (see here), the same does not happen in DYModule.py (see here), i.e., DYModule.py plots responses regardless of the printing level.

On a side note, some plot naming may be wrong: for example here we apply noSel selection but call the plot hasTwoSFLeptons, which sounds inconsistent.

Name change for rho variable between Run2 and Run3 NanoAODs

The README currently recommends to do

sed -i 's/"fixedGridRhoFastjetAll"/"Rho_fixedGridRhoFastjetAll"/g' bamboo/bamboo/analysisutils.py

in order to run on Run3 NanoAOD, where the ฯ variable is called Rho_fixedGridRhoFastjetAll. This clearly makes the code crash when attempting to read Run2 samples, which still have the old naming.
This needs either to be treated in the code or harmonized by future NanoAOD versions (maybe with coherent naming?)
